# Break-Glass: Catalog Cache Invalidation

Scope: the Pinrow product catalog at Veldstone Retail. If stale prices persist after a purge and the Hollowmere invalidation queue is wedged, use break-glass to flush the edge tier directly. Contractors: get verbal sign-off from the catalog lead first. Steps: open the Hollowmere admin shell, select emergency-flush, confirm the tenant, and run it once — repeated flushes thrash the origin. Access is logged and expires after 20 minutes. Unseal the admin shell with the passphrase below.

recovery phrase for kahop-tajog: istix-casvan

Capacity note for the Fennelgrid sidecar review. Aggregation window widened to cut emit rate; per-pod memory ceiling holds at current cardinality (~12k series). CPU flat. Risk: buffer overflow if a tenant spikes labels — mitigated by the drop policy. No node-pool changes needed for the Caldermoor cluster this quarter. Review the flush and buffer settings before merge. Constants under review are below.

limits module of yafop-hahag:
QUOTAS = {
    "tamwyn": 652,
    "prawyn": 731,
}

Runbook: Calendar sync conflict (Plannerly). Symptom: duplicate or vanishing events after a two-way sync with Meetrix. Check the conflict queue first; if it exceeds 50 entries, pause sync for the affected tenant. Do not replay events manually — the reconciler handles ordering. Escalate only if the queue keeps growing after a pause. Before escalating, capture the tenant's active sync configuration, which is listed below.

deployment values, yadug-bawif:
[framir]
team = pelox
access_code = ac_a38ab2
owner = tamion.julael
host = framir.tolvaqlabs.test
port = 11211
peer = tammir.zemvargrid.local
salt = 2215ef03
pin = 1541